What is an example of an impact statement for personal injury?
For example, you could say, “The accident left me with not just physical scars, but it also shook my confidence. Now, just getting in a car to go to work or see my loved ones has become difficult.” Focus on the future impact. Discuss the immediate aftermath and the incident's long-term effects on your life.

What can't you say in a Victim Impact Statement?
Don't describe what you want to happen to the offender in prison. Please do not get descriptive about any harm you would like to see imposed. Don't put personal, identifying information in your letter and do not say it verbally in court.

How do you write an emotional Victim Impact Statement?
Recommendations • Your Victim Impact Statement should be truthful and speak from your heart. The statement can be an all-encompassing document which addresses how the defendant's actions and the trauma that followed affected your physical, emotional, financial, and spiritual well-being.

What is an example of a powerful Victim Impact Statement?
Sample VIS Letter Doe have greatly affected my life. Since he committed this crime, I have been unable to sleep at night. I am constantly afraid that someone will break into my home and injure me again. I am no longer able to trust people as I did before.
